PRESS RELEASE
02 May 2023

CONDUCT OF THE MAY 2023 CHEMICAL ENGINEERS LICENSURE


EXAMINATION

The Professional Regulation Commission (PRC) announces the conduct of the May 16,
17 and 18, 2023 Chemical Engineers Licensure Examination (ChELE) to 101
examinees at Skyrise Hotel, Dominican Hill Road, Baguio City.

Examinees coming OUTSIDE of Baguio, La Trinidad, ltogon, Sablan, Tuba and Tublay
shall strictly adhere to the latest entry protocols of Baguio City as posted at
www.facebook.com/pio.baguio.

At the PRC EXAMINATION VENUE, all examinees shall bring the following:

1. Notice of Admission;
2. ANY of the following (ALINMAN SA MGA SUMUSUNOD):
a. Photocopy of the complete Vaccination Card/Certificate if fully vaccinated
(An individual is considered FULLY VACCINATED FOR COVID-19 after a
period of at least two (2) weeks from having received the second dose of a
2-dose series; or after a period of two (2) weeks from having received a
single-dose vaccine). Last dose should have been administered on or
before May 1, 2023; BOOSTER shot is not required but highly
encouraged;
b. Hard copy of the negative RT-PCR test result (NOT Antigen test) if not
fully vaccinated, date of collection shall be within 72 hours;

Note, however, that for examinees who recently contracted COVID-19, a


Certificate of Completion of Isolation or its equivalent signed by ANY of
the following must be submitted:
(a) Government or private licensed physician
(b) Municipal Health Officer, Provincial Health Officer, or City Health
Officer
(c) Designated Barangay Health Emergency Response Team (BHERT}
Officer or Barangay Health Worker visiting the residence of the
examinee

3. One (1) piece long transparent plastic envelope


4. One (1) piece long brown envelope
5. Two or more pencils (No. 2)
6. Pens with BLACK ink only
7. Allowed non-programmable calculator
8. Packed snacks and meals with sufficient drinking water supply as no one will be
allowed to go out once inside the examination venue
9. Medicine, hygiene and sanitary kits, and related supplies, when necessary

The PRC-CAR will not photocopy or print your compliance documents so please
prepare the documents stated in item numbers 1 and 2.
Refer to the program of examination for other things to bring, required attire, allowed
and prohibited items.

PROFESSIONAL REGULATORY BOARD OF CHEMICAL ENGINEERING

PROGRAM OF THE CHEMICAL ENGINEERING LICENSURE


EXAMINATION IN MANILA, BAGUIO, ILOILO, DAVAO, ROSALES, LEGAZPI, CAGAYAN DE ORO
AND CEBU CITIES ON MAY 16, 17 AND 18, 2023.

DATE AND TIME S U B J E CT S WEIGHT Remarks

TUESDAY, MAY 16, 2023

7:00 A.M. - 7:45 A.M. - G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S


FILLING OUT OF FORMS

8:00 A.M. - 2:00 P.M. - PHYSICAL AND CHEMICAL


PRINCIPLES -30% Use of Perry’s Handbook
General Inorganic Chemistry; (7th, 8th or 9th editions) and
Organic Chemistry; Analytical Updated Periodic Table
Chemistry; Physical Chemistry; Allow ed
Biochemical Engineering; and
Environmental Engineering
WEDNESDAY, MAY 17, 2023

8:00 A.M. - 5:00 P.M. - CHEMICAL ENGINEERING


PRINCIPLES - 40% Use of Perry’s Handbook
Chemical Engineering Calculations; (7th, 8th or 9th editions) and
Chemical Engineering Thermodynamics; Updated Periodic Table
Reaction Kinetics; Unit Operations; Allow ed
Chemical Process Industries,
Plant Design; and Instrumentation
and Process Control

THURSDAY, MAY 18, 2023

8:00 A.M. - 2:00 P.M. - GENERAL ENGINEERING, ETHICS


AND CONTRACTS - 30% Use of Handbook and
Mathematics; Physics; Engineering Periodic Table
Mechanics; Strength of Materials; NOT
Engineering Economics; and Laws, ALLOWED
Contracts and Ethics

TOTAL 100%

10. Use of Perry’s Chemical Engineers’ Handbook (7th, 8th or 9th editions) and updated
Periodic Table shall be allowed ONLY in “Physical and Chemical Principles” and in
“Chemical Engineering Principles”

a. The examinees have to choose which of the two editions to bring inside the
examination room. Only 1 handbook is allowed per examinee.
b. Handbook must be in its original printed form. Photocopy or xerox copy is not
allowed.
c. Handbook must not have any handwritten formula, sample problem, notation or
any such kind of writing or added information.
d. Insertion of photocopied pages, printed sheets or any other form of written
materials is strictly prohibited.
e. Only bookmarks, tabs, underlines and highlights are allowed.
f. Any loose sheet shall not be permitted.

The proctors/watchers reserve the right to confiscate and/or refuse the use of Handbook
found questionable or in violation of the above restrictions. Any willful attempt to use the
Page 4 of 4

Handbook as a means to cheat shall be dealt with accordingly and shall be a ground for
disqualification from taking the licensure examination.

11. In the “General Engineering, Ethics and Contracts” subject (on Day 3, May 18, 2023),
the use of Handbook and Periodic Table is strictly not allowed.
